diff options
author | 2011-01-28 09:52:27 +0000 | |
---|---|---|
committer | 2011-01-28 09:52:27 +0000 | |
commit | cec6c28f5e7f5e0be6ac12a7d21f557c32c0d2cd (patch) | |
tree | 781de3636e51ca3aafde70faea498ec8ad3cd268 /www-client | |
parent | EAPI3 (diff) | |
download | gentoo-2-cec6c28f5e7f5e0be6ac12a7d21f557c32c0d2cd.tar.gz gentoo-2-cec6c28f5e7f5e0be6ac12a7d21f557c32c0d2cd.tar.bz2 gentoo-2-cec6c28f5e7f5e0be6ac12a7d21f557c32c0d2cd.zip |
Remove system-sqlite USE flag, it's broken upstream. Bug #352892 by fkhp <fkhp101@tom.com>.
(Portage version: 2.1.9.25/cvs/Linux i686)
Diffstat (limited to 'www-client')
-rw-r--r-- | www-client/chromium/ChangeLog | 6 | ||||
-rw-r--r-- | www-client/chromium/chromium-9999.ebuild | 19 |
2 files changed, 8 insertions, 17 deletions
diff --git a/www-client/chromium/ChangeLog b/www-client/chromium/ChangeLog index 8e40e85e2372..a6f490f55450 100644 --- a/www-client/chromium/ChangeLog +++ b/www-client/chromium/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for www-client/chromium #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/www-client/chromium/ChangeLog,v 1.268 2011/01/27 10:46:25 phajdan.jr Exp $ +# $Header: /var/cvsroot/gentoo-x86/www-client/chromium/ChangeLog,v 1.269 2011/01/28 09:52:27 phajdan.jr Exp $ + + 28 Jan 2011; Pawel Hajdan jr <phajdan.jr@gentoo.org> chromium-9999.ebuild: + Remove system-sqlite USE flag, it's broken upstream. Bug #352892 by fkhp + <fkhp101@tom.com>. *chromium-10.0.648.6 (27 Jan 2011) diff --git a/www-client/chromium/chromium-9999.ebuild b/www-client/chromium/chromium-9999.ebuild index 91b5bda39674..a9123019edec 100644 --- a/www-client/chromium/chromium-9999.ebuild +++ b/www-client/chromium/chromium-9999.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2011 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/www-client/chromium/chromium-9999.ebuild,v 1.128 2011/01/22 16:18:21 phajdan.jr Exp $ +# $Header: /var/cvsroot/gentoo-x86/www-client/chromium/chromium-9999.ebuild,v 1.129 2011/01/28 09:52:27 phajdan.jr Exp $ EAPI="3" PYTHON_DEPEND="2:2.6" @@ -17,12 +17,9 @@ EGCLIENT_REPO_URI="http://src.chromium.org/svn/trunk/src/" LICENSE="BSD" SLOT="0" KEYWORDS="" -IUSE="cups +gecko-mediaplayer gnome gnome-keyring system-sqlite" +IUSE="cups +gecko-mediaplayer gnome gnome-keyring" RDEPEND="app-arch/bzip2 - system-sqlite? ( - >=dev-db/sqlite-3.6.23.1[fts3,icu,secure-delete,threadsafe] - ) dev-lang/v8 dev-libs/dbus-glib >=dev-libs/icu-4.4.1 @@ -198,13 +195,6 @@ src_prepare() { rmdir v8/include || die ln -s /usr/include v8/include || die - if use system-sqlite; then - # Remove bundled sqlite, preserving the shim header. - find third_party/sqlite -type f \! -iname '*.gyp*' \ - \! -path 'third_party/sqlite/sqlite3.h' \ - -delete || die - fi - # Make sure the build system will use the right python, bug #344367. # Only convert directories that need it, to save time. python_convert_shebangs -q -r 2 build tools @@ -220,6 +210,7 @@ src_configure() { # Use system-provided libraries. # TODO: use_system_hunspell (upstream changes needed). # TODO: use_system_ssl (need to consult upstream). + # TODO: use_system_sqlite (http://crbug.com/22208). myconf+=" -Duse_system_bzip2=1 -Duse_system_ffmpeg=1 @@ -234,10 +225,6 @@ src_configure() { -Duse_system_xdg_utils=1 -Duse_system_zlib=1" - if use system-sqlite; then - myconf+=" -Duse_system_sqlite=1" - fi - # The dependency on cups is optional, see bug #324105. if use cups; then myconf+=" -Duse_cups=1" |